Q: Is 762,241,407 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 762,241,407 is a composite number.

Why is 762,241,407 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 762,241,407 can be evenly divided by 1 3 311 439 933 1,317 1,861 5,583 136,529 409,587 578,771 816,979 1,736,313 2,450,937 254,080,469 and 762,241,407, with no remainder.

Since 762,241,407 cannot be divided by just 1 and 762,241,407, it is a composite number.
